Who we are:
A family-owned business since 1919, in Walkerton Ontario, Larsen & Shaw has been a leading hinge manufacturer producing top quality Custom Hinges, Standard Continuous Hinges and architectural products as well as a wide variety of other hinges, hardware, and metal stampings. As the Senior Purchasing Manager you will report to the Chief Executive Officer and manage the Purchasing team to ensure that operational targets are met.
The Ideal Candidate:
• Post-secondary degree/diploma in Materials Management, Finance or a related discipline, or equivalent combination of education and experience
• Minimum 3 years of leadership/management experience
• Demonstrated ability to develop, implement and maintain Continuous Improvement and LEAN principles.
• Proficient computer skills including Microsoft Word, Excel and MRP software
• Proven problem solving, organizational and decision-making skills necessary to coordinate multiple projects and work priorities to meet deadlines.
Joining the team means that you will:
• Manage the Purchasing Department, learn all aspects of the department and provide coverage as required.
• Maintain Standard and Department Operation Procedures to ensure compliance with customer, company and legislated regulations and procedures.
• Source, research, negotiate and order supplies for the company
• Oversee freight and traffic activities
• Responsible for the day-to-day operations of scheduling for On-Time Delivery and Promised delivery Days
• Maintain the MRO/RM Program
• Participate in discussions with the team to determine in-coming raw materials and strategize conflict situations
